Abstract
- Use of traceable particles in flue gas was viable for 2D PIV in thermal test boiler.
- PIV results were verified by numerical simulation to reflect actual flow in furnaces.
- The excess air ratios only affected the magnitude of the main flow velocity of flue gas.
- The flow field under higher load conditions was more stable due to higher rigidity.
